Exporting your course for reusing in a future course

(Strongly recommended) Exporting the course and downloading it to your local computer

  1. In the Course Management section, your home office, open the Packages and Utilities tab. Then click “Export/Archive Course.”
  2. Click the “Export-Package” option. On the "Export Course" page, scroll down to the “Select Course Materials” section and click “Select All.” 
  3. At the bottom right, click Submit.
    Note: While usually a question of minutes and a simple click on the refresh button on the Export/Archive Course page, in rare cases it may take up to an hour for you to see a very long exported course link on the Export/Archive Course page and to receive an email notification to that effect. 
  4. On the Export/Archive Course page, download your exported course by clicking on the link and saving the file to your computer.
  5. Do not change the file name and save it in a folder you name “Exported Blackboard Courses.”
  6. Lastly, return to the Export/Archive Course page, click on the hidden action button next to the exported file name and select “Delete”. Done!
